Subject: Master copies for Lintmere Print Works

Dispatch,

The master copies for the Ashfell catalogue reprint are boxed and waiting at the warehouse office. Shift lead has been told to release them only against a signed dispatch slip. These are the only originals, so the run cannot be combined with other deliveries. Collection is booked for tomorrow morning.

The confidential hand-over instruction for the courier follows below.

courier memo of tawep-tajep: the quenius ulaiel courier leaves the fenir ledger at gate 9128 under passcode 527513

**Ticket QMX-4412: Compactor vault locked, Brimfeather queue stalled**

Log compaction on the Brimfeather message queue halted overnight because the compactor can't open its credentials vault after the node reboot. Segments are piling up on partition 7 and disk is at 81%. On-call: unseal the vault manually, then restart the compaction worker. The unseal prompt takes the recovery passphrase noted below.

unlock words, hahip-baduf: holwyn-istath-julvan

## Runbook: Courierd WebSocket Reconnect Loop

Symptom: clients thrash between connect/disconnect every ~10s. Cause: stale session tokens rejected by the Relay tier after failover. Mitigation: drain affected Relay nodes, bump `reconnect_backoff_max` to 120s, redeploy. Verify with `courierd-probe --watch`. The probe needs to authenticate against the internal Relay admin endpoint using the key below.

gateway credential: kto23_LX9A4ys6i4nzHtpOLNLodKK